├── README.md ├── Youtube-dl downloader.py └── LICENSE /README.md: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| # pythonista-youtubedl-downloader 2 | 3 | ## Note: I have decided to no longer support this project, I will be archiving this project in the near future. 4 | 5 | Script to download [youtube-dl from main repo](https://github.com/rg3/youtube-dl), and patch it work in [Pythonista](http://omz-software.com/pythonista) on iOS devices. 6 | 7 | This script is not meant to download videos using youtube-dl but instead to download, backup, and restore youtube-dl itself. 8 | 9 | It was inspired by https://github.com/HyShai/youtube-dl which you should check out if you want to understand how to use youtube-dl in Pythonista. 10 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/Youtube-dl downloader.py: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| #! python3 2 | # coding: utf-8 3 | # youtube-dl downloader is used to download youtube_dl and patch it to work in Pythonista. 4 | # Replace function came from http://stackoverflow.com/questions/39086/search-and-replace-a-line-in-a-file-in-python 5 | # Download file was adapted from Python file downloader (https://gist.github.com/89edf288a15fde45682a) 6 | 7 | import console 8 | import os 9 | import requests 10 | import shutil 11 | import tempfile 12 | import time 13 | import ui 14 | import zipfile 15 | 16 | youtubedl_location = os.path.expanduser('~/Documents/site-packages/') 17 | youtubedl_dir = 'youtube_dl' 18 | 19 | backup_location = './backup/youtube_dl/' 20 | youtubedl_downloadurl = 'https://github.com/rg3/youtube-dl/archive/master.zip' 21 | youtubedl_unarchive_location = './youtube-dl-master/' 22 | files_to_change = [('utils.py','import ctypes','#import ctypes'), 23 | ('utils.py','import pipes','#import pipes'), 24 | ('YoutubeDL.py','self._err_file.isatty() and ',''), 25 | ('downloader/common.py','(\'\r\x1b[K\' if sys.stderr.isatty() else \'\r\')','\'r\''), 26 | ('downloader/common.py','(\'\r\x1b[K\' if sys.stderr.isatty() else \'\r\')','\r'), 27 | ('extractor/common.py',' and sys.stderr.isatty()','')] 28 | 29 | def backup_youtubedl(sender): 30 | console.show_activity('Checking for youtube-dl') 31 | if os.path.isdir(you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ir): 32 | console.show_activity('Backing up youtube-dl') 33 | if not os.path.exists(backup_location): 34 | os.makedirs(backup_location) 35 | shutil.move(you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ir,backup_location+youtubedl_dir+ time.strftime('%Y%m%d%H%M%S')) 36 | console.hide_activity() 37 | 38 | @ui.in_background 39 | def restore_youtubedl_backup(sender): 40 | if not os.path.isdir(backup_location) or not os.listdir(backup_location): 41 | console.alert('Nothing to do', 'No backups found to restore') 42 | else: 43 | folders = os.listdir(backup_location) 44 | folder = folders[len(folders)-1] 45 | shutil.move(backup_location+folder,you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ir) 46 | console.alert('Success','Successfully restored '+folder) 47 | 48 | def downloadfile(url): 49 | localFilename = url.split('/')[-1] or 'download' 50 | with open(localFilename, 'wb') as f: 51 | r = requests.get(url, stream=True) 52 | total_length = r.headers.get('content-length') 53 | if total_length: 54 | dl = 0 55 | total_length = float(total_length) 56 | for chunk in r.iter_content(1024): 57 | dl += len(chunk) 58 | f.write(chunk) 59 | #.setprogress(dl/total_length*100.0) 60 | else: 61 | f.write(r.content) 62 | return localFilename 63 | 64 | def process_file(path): 65 | if zipfile.is_zipfile(path): 66 | zipfile.ZipFile(path).extractall() 67 | 68 | @ui.in_background 69 | def update_youtubedl(sender): 70 | if os.path.exists(you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ir): 71 | msg = 'Are you sure you want to update youtubedl exists in site-packages and will be overwritten' 72 | if not console.alert('Continue',msg,'OK'): 73 | return 74 | console.show_activity('Downloading') 75 | file = downloadfile(youtubedl_downloadurl) 76 | console.show_activity('Extracting') 77 | process_file(file) 78 | console.show_activity('Moving') 79 | if os.path.exists(you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ir): 80 | shutil.rmtree(you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ir) 81 | shutil.move(youtubedl_unarchive_location+youtubedl_dir, you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ir) 82 | console.show_activity('Cleaning Up Download Files') 83 | shutil.rmtree(youtubedl_unarchive_location) 84 | os.remove(file) 85 | console.show_activity('Making youtube-dl friendly') 86 | process_youtubedl_for_pythonista() 87 | console.hide_activity() 88 | 89 | def process_youtubedl_for_pythonista(): 90 | for patch in files_to_change: 91 | filename, old_str, new_str = patch 92 | replace_in_file(youtubedl_location+youtubedl_dir+'/'+filename, old_str, new_str) 93 | 94 | def replace_in_file(file_path, old_str, new_str): 95 | with open(file_path, encoding='utf-8') as old_file: 96 | #Create temp file 97 | fh, abs_path = tempfile.mkstemp() 98 | os.close(fh) # close low level and reopen high level 99 | with open(abs_path, encoding='utf-8', mode='w') as new_file: 100 | for line in old_file: 101 | new_file.write(line.replace(old_str, new_str)) 102 | #Remove original file 103 | os.remove(file_path) 104 | #Move new file 105 | shutil.move(abs_path, file_path) 106 | 107 | def make_button(title, action): 108 | button = ui.Button(title=title) 109 | button.action = action 110 | button.background_color ='lightgrey' 111 | button.border_color = 'black' 112 | button.border_width = 1 113 | button.flex = 'WB' 114 | return button 115 | 116 | console.hide_activity() 117 | view = ui.View(frame=(0,0,172,132)) 118 | view.background_color = 'white' 119 | 120 | backup_button = make_button(title='Backup YoutubeDL', action=backup_youtubedl) 121 | backup_button.center = (view.width * 0.5, view.y+backup_button.height) 122 | view.add_subview(backup_button) 123 | 124 | restore_button = make_button(title='Restore YoutubeDL', action=restore_youtubedl_backup) 125 | restore_button.center = (view.width * 0.5, backup_button.y+restore_button.height*1.75) 126 | view.add_subview(restore_button) 127 | 128 | download_button = make_button(title='Download YoutubeDL', action=update_youtubedl) 129 | download_button.center = (view.width * 0.5, restore_button.y+download_button.height*1.75) 130 | view.add_subview(download_button) 131 | 132 | view.present('sheet') 133 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/LICENSE: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| Apache License 2 | Version 2.0, January 2004 3 | http://www.apache.org/licenses/ 4 | 5 | TERMS AND CONDITIONS FOR USE, REPRODUCTION, AND DISTRIBUTION 6 | 7 | 1.
